What Hardware Manufacturers Produce
The county's hardware manufacturers cover a broad spectrum of products. These include printed circuit boards, electronic assemblies, sensors, control systems and specialist components. Many offer contract manufacturing services, producing hardware to their clients' designs, while others develop and sell their own products.
Precision and reliability are hallmarks of the best manufacturers. They invest in modern equipment, rigorous quality control and skilled technicians to ensure that every product meets exacting standards. This focus on quality is particularly important in sectors where components must perform flawlessly in critical applications.

Manufacturing Trends and Innovation
The hardware manufacturing sector is evolving rapidly. Automation and smart manufacturing techniques are improving efficiency and consistency, while advanced design and simulation tools shorten development cycles. Manufacturers are also embracing the Internet of Things, embedding connectivity into products to enable monitoring and control.
Sustainability is an increasing priority. Leading manufacturers are reducing waste, improving energy efficiency and considering the environmental impact of materials and processes. This reflects both regulatory pressure and growing customer expectations for responsible production.
Quality, Compliance and Reliability
Quality and compliance are central to hardware manufacturing. Products must meet relevant standards and, in many sectors, undergo rigorous testing and certification. The best manufacturers maintain robust quality management systems, ensuring traceability and consistency throughout the production process.
Reliability is especially critical in applications where failure is not an option. Manufacturers serving demanding sectors invest heavily in testing and quality assurance, building reputations founded on dependable products and consistent performance.
